Timely action by railway staff averts mishap

Hoshiarpur (Punjab), Apr 29 (UNI) An accident was averted in the early hours on Tuesday thanks to the prompt response of the railway staff at Tanda Urmur railway station, ensuring the safety of passengers aboard the Hemkunt Express train and preventing a significant delay.
According to SHO, Government Railway Police (GRP), Jalandhar, Inspector Ashok Kumar, around
1:30 am, the Hemkunt Express, en route from Haridwar to Jammu was forced to halt on the outskirts
of Tanda Urmur station near Chandigarh Colony due to the signal not turning green on the Jalandhar-Jammu rail route.
The unexpected stop raised safety concerns and hinted at a possible disruption.
Upon noticing that the track points had not changed, the Station Master at Tanda Urmur immediately dispatched a pointsman to inspect the situation. The pointsman discovered that the track had been blocked with stones, and a roughly three-inch-long piece of iron was also found placed on it.
Displaying swift presence of mind, the pointsman cleared the obstruction in about 10 minutes, allowing the Hemkunt Express to resume its journey with only a 15-minute delay.
Officials suspect foul play and termed the act a deliberate attempt to cause disruption. The Railway Protection Force (RPF) has initiated proceedings under the Railway Act. Both RPF and GRP have launched a joint investigation from all possible angles to ascertain the motive and identify the miscreants.
Action will be taken based on the outcome of the probe, said Inspector Ashok Kumar.
